bi⋅se⋅ri⋅al

[bahy-seer-ee-uhl]
–adjective Statistics.
of or pertaining to the correlation between two sets of measurements, one set of which is limited to one of two values.

Origin:
1830–40; bi- 1 + serial


bi⋅se⋅ri⋅al⋅ly, adverb
